The cheapest way to get from Southend-on-Sea to Carnac is to bus which costs €50 - €190 and takes 21h 21m.
The fastest way to get from Southend-on-Sea to Carnac is to train and fly which takes 9h 15m and costs €100 - €330.
No, there is no direct bus from Southend-on-Sea station to Carnac. The distance between Southend-on-Sea and Carnac is 1048 km.
The best way to get from Southend-on-Sea to Carnac without a car is to train which takes 10h 3m and costs €150 - €550.
It takes approximately 10h 3m to get from Southend-on-Sea to Carnac, including transfers.
